How many moles of NaOH are in a 356 mL solution that has a concentration of 7.2 M?

Respuesta :

ashish4112119
ashish4112119 ashish4112119
  • 04-08-2022

Answer:

2.56 moles

Explanation:

7.2 M is 7.2 moles/L

356 mL = .356 Liters

x moles / .356 Liters = 7.2 M (moles/L)

x = .356 * 7.2 = 2.5632 moles
